原文:简述消息队列在电商系统使用场景以及工作模式

概述 消息队列 Message Queue ,是分布式系统中重要的组件,是一种进程间通信或者是同一进程的不同线程的通信方式。和 http 同步协议不同的是,消息队列是一种异步的通信协议,不需要立即获得结果。 消息队列的使用场景 异步处理 流量控制 应用解耦 应用解耦 消息队列的一个作用就是实现系统应用之间的解耦。举例一下电商系统的中的订单系统。 当创建一个订单时: 发起支付 扣减库存 发消息告知用 ...

2021-11-18 08:39 0 820 推荐指数:

查看详情

消息队列---消息模型及使用场景

消息队列   消息对列是一个存放消息的容器,当我们需要消息的时候就从消息队列中取出消息使用消息队列是分布式系统中重要的组件,使用消息队列的目的是为了通过异步处理提高系统的性能和削峰值,降低系统的耦合性。目前使用较多的消息队列有ActiveMQ,RabbitMQ,Kafka,RocketMQ ...

Mon Jul 08 01:51:00 CST 2019 0 847
消息队列,常见的 5 种使用场景

消息队列中间件是分布式系统中重要的组件,主要解决应用耦合,异步消息,流量削锋等问题 实现高性能,高可用,可伸缩和最终一致性架构。 使用较多的消息队列有 RocketMQ,RabbitMQ,Kafka,ZeroMQ,MetaMQ 以下介绍消息队列在实际应用中常用的使用场景。 异步处理,应用 ...

Thu Aug 26 06:35:00 CST 2021 0 145
消息队列使用场景及优缺点?

(1)为什么使用消息队列啊? 其实就是问问你消息队列都有哪些使用场景,然后你项目里具体是什么场景,说说你在这个场景里用消息队列是什么 面试官问你这个问题,期望的一个回答是说,你们公司有个什么业务场景,这个业务场景有个什么技术挑战,如果不用MQ可能会很麻烦,但是你现在用了MQ之后带给 ...

Sun Sep 02 18:37:00 CST 2018 1 11525
MQ(1)---消息队列概念和使用场景

消息队列概念和使用场景 声明:本文转自:MQ入门总结(一)消息队列概念和使用场景 写的很好,都不用自己在整理了,非常感谢该作者的用心。 一、什么是消息队列 消息即是信息的载体。为了让消息发送者 ...

Wed May 23 05:00:00 CST 2018 0 948
使用策略模式重构折扣和支付场景

本文节选自《设计模式就该这样学》 1 使用策略模式实现促销优惠方案选择 大家都知道,咕泡学院的架构师课程经常会有优惠活动,优惠策略有很多种可能,如领取优惠券抵扣、返现促销、拼团优惠等。下面用代码来模拟,首先创建一个促销策略的抽象PromotionStrategy。 然后分别创建 ...

Fri Nov 05 22:31:00 CST 2021 0 912
消息队列的应用场景

队列在数据结构中是一种线性表,从一端插入数据,然后从另一端删除数据。本文目的不是讲解各种队列算法,而是在应用层面讲述使用队列能解决哪些场景问题。 在我开发过的系统中,不是所有的业务都必须实时处理、不是所有的请求都必须实时反馈结果给用户、不是所有的请求/处理都必须100%处理成功、不知道谁依赖 ...

Thu Jun 07 19:50:00 CST 2018 0 1054
消息队列用场景

1异步处理 场景说明:用户注册后,需要发注册邮件和注册短信。传统的做法有两种1.串行的方式;2.并行方式。 (1)串行方式:将注册信息写入数据库成功后,发送注册邮件,再发送注册短信。以上三个任务全部完成后,返回给客户端。(架构KKQ:466097527,欢迎加入) (2)并行方式:将注册 ...

Mon Apr 11 05:10:00 CST 2016 22 35690
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M